Répondre à la discussion
Page 1 sur 2 1 DernièreDernière
Affichage des résultats 1 à 30 sur 32

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soir!



  1. #1
    Canaillou2k5

    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soir!

    Bonjour, j'ai fini d'assembler mon circuit qui fonctionnait parfaitement sur labdec.

    Il est dans le boitier, etc... avant je rencontrais un problème de reset lorsque le moteur démarrais; maintenant ca le fait aléatoirement et je ne sait vraiment pas quoi faire.

    De plus je doit rendre le boitier ce soir.

    J'ai rajouter des condos, un de 100nF et de 1000uF aux bornes du micro contrôleur; ça ne change rien je ne sait pas du tout de quoi ça peut venir.

    Code:
     Cliquez pour afficher


    EN PJ : le schéma de montage; le routage et deux photo de la catre

    -----

    Images attachées Images attachées

  2. Publicité
  3. #2
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Avez vous des pistes pour detecter la panne? point de mesures qui m'aurais échapper?

    Merci.

  4. #3
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    J'ai des premiers test qui donne quelque chose d'étrange:

    J'ai une alim parfaitement continue à vide qui provient d'un petit chargeur:

    lorsque je branche le fusible cela ondule un petit peut: normal

    Mais lorsque je le branche à l'ordinateur (port USB) qui est en plus sur batterie ça devrais pas onduler c'est du 100% DC !

    Donc je suppose qu'il y à un composant qui pose de problème, cela peut-il venir d'un condensateur?

    Autres chose, à petit vitesse le ça semble moins bugger, à grande vitesse ça tien seulement quelque secondes; donc je suppose que dans le fond c'est toujours ce moteur qui pose problème.
    Dernière modification par Canaillou2k5 ; 01/09/2011 à 15h19.

  5. #4
    PIXEL

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    hello ,

    le test d'usage dans ce cas :alimente la partie moteur par une ligne 12V provenant d'une autre alim.

    ça lèvera le loup

  6. #5
    DAUDET78

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Le cuivre montré n'est pas celui de la photo de la maquette ?
    Si c'est le même, le circuit du 0V qui du µC passe par la source du NMOS et va sur les capas du quartz ..... c'est chercher les emmerdes

    Ta charge, c'est un moteur? il manque une diode de roue libre ?

    Si tu mets une résistance de la puissance du moteur à la place du moteur, ça marche?
    L'age n'est pas un handicap .... Encore faut-il arriver jusque là pour le constater !

  7. A voir en vidéo sur Futura
  8. #6
    PIXEL

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    effectivement , la "ligne de masse" est l'exemple de ce qu'il ne faut pas faire.

    ça c'est le résultat calamiteux d'un routeur automatique.

    quans j'usions nos fonds de culottes , nos prof nous conseillaient "vigoureusement" d'adopter le "cadre de masse épais"
    qui fait le tour de la carte

  9. Publicité
  10. #7
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Le cuivre montré n'est pas celui de la photo de la maquette ? - j'ai mal compris la question mais je pense que oui

    Si c'est le même, le circuit du 0V qui du µC passe par la source du NMOS et va sur les capas du quartz ..... c'est chercher les emmerdes - le 0 du micro est du côté de la date, pas à l'intérieur

    Ta charge, c'est un moteur? il manque une diode de roue libre ? - la diode de roue libre est aux bornes du moteur

    Si tu mets une résistance de la puissance du moteur à la place du moteur, ça marche? - je vient d'essayer d'isoler les alims, même problème je vais essayer ça maintenant.


    effectivement , la "ligne de masse" est l'exemple de ce qu'il ne faut pas faire.

    ça c'est le résultat calamiteux d'un routeur automatique. non ce n'est pas un routage automatique; j'ai pas mal changer la borde avant de faire le cicruit, c'est pour ça qu'il y à tout les vias, j'ai pensé que c'était mieux que de faire passer 4 fils sous une puce par exemple.

    J'ai également largement écarté le plan de masse des pistes suites au problèmes rencontrés pour réaliser la carte.

    Voilà en pièce jointe le plan de masse. Le point entouré en rouge je suppose que c'est pas top, mais le courant qui transite par ce retour est celui sur capteur de vitesse, le plan de masse à l'intérieur je l'ai relier au reste par un pont de toute façon et non pas par cette pin...

    J'ai également joint le plan de câblage exact, avec de 1 à 2 correspond de gauche à droite sur le routage
    Images attachées Images attachées
    Dernière modification par Canaillou2k5 ; 01/09/2011 à 16h16.

  11. #8
    PIXEL

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    as-tu fais le test recommandé en #4 ?

  12. #9
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    J'ai fait un pont à l'endroit indiqué en vert, c'est beaucoup plus stable.

    Je pense que je vais couper à l'endroit en rouge mais pas sur que ça soit utile.

    Si tu mets une résistance de la puissance du moteur à la place du moteur, ça marche? - je vient d'essayer d'isoler les alims, même problème je vais essayer ça maintenant.
    .


    Oui je l'ai fait.
    Images attachées Images attachées
    Dernière modification par Canaillou2k5 ; 01/09/2011 à 16h34.

  13. #10
    Franck-026

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    un montage fonctionnel peut devenir totalement pourri pour peu qu'on route un circuit de la maniere la pire. Le strap montre que ca s'ameliore? il te faudra revoir entierement le routage, et ne pas plaindre le remplissage avec de la masse. c'est le B A ba du routage... Et avec les routeurs auto, on obtient vraiment n'importe quoi...

  14. #11
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Non ça c'est améliorer un temps mais finalement le problème est toujours bien présent.

    Ce routage n'a pas été fait automatiquement (même si dans le fond c'est pire pour moi mais je suis honnête)

    et ne pas plaindre le remplissage avec de la masse. c'est le B A ba du routage...
    Ca j'ai pas compris.

    J'ai repris le sud de la carte, je pense que je vais la refaire, mais je ne suis pas non plus sur que ça va résoudre mon problème! si?
    Images attachées Images attachées

  15. #12
    bobflux

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Certes, le routage est à chier mais le placement aussi. En fait le gros problème c'est qu'en simple face, c'est difficile. Si tu tiens vraiment à le faire en simple face, il ne faut pas avoir peur de faire une carte plus grande histoire de moins tasser la puissance sur ce qui peut être perturbé.

    Là, par exemple, le condensateur de découplage du uC devrait être juste à côté du uC. Or il est loin, et la trace de masse du condensateur n'est pas reliée directement à la pin de masse du uC, mais passe par la masse puissance : ça ne peut pas marcher... avec le strap en vert et la coupure en rouge, ça devrait arranger les choses.

    Sinon, déssoude la petite capa de découplage (C1, 100nF) et soude-la en travers sur le uC, directement sur les broches. Et ajoute quelque chose en série avec D1, l'idéal serait une ferrite, mais si t'en as pas sous la main, mets une résistance de 10 ohms.

  16. Publicité
  17. #13
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Je n'ai pas de double face pour le moment mais le problème c'est que c'est pile poil pour le boitier, l'emplacement de l'encodeur, des digits et la sortie des fils est imposé, donc moins facile.

    Je ne l'ai pas dit mais actuellement y'a un condo de 100nF tiré entre le Vcc et la masse du micro, c'est la première chose que j'ai faite....

    Je vais tenter le coupure en rouge quand même.

  18. #14
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Finalement je commence à douter quand à la source réele du problème, car voilà comment j'ai coupé:

    -Cad le 0V des condos du quartz et celui du micro et ce l'alim sont reliés par des fils de moins d'1 cm; le micro à toujours sont condo de 100nF à ses bornes directement.

    -le "retour puissance" est isolé du reste.

    La partie comune de la commande et de la puissance sont au niveau de la masse du câble d'alim, je peut pas plus les isolés...

    Lorsqu'il se reset et que je visualise à l'oscillo le Vcc ou la pin reset (y'a surement pas le temps) mais rien ne se passe, pas de parasites, pas de chute de tension...

  19. #15
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Quand je branche la masse de mon oscillo ça bug plus (ou je n'ai pas assez été patient...) mais bon difficile de visualiser le problème maintenant.

  20. #16
    MorpheusPic

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    salut

    tu peut peut etre diminuer la frequence du quarts voir si l'uc est moin sensible au parasites ... essai aussi de relier la carcasse du quartz au plan de masse

    utilise tu du PWM pour ton moteur ? si oui, tu peut essayer de trouver la frequence qui te genere le moin de parasites ...

  21. #17
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Très bien là je part, j'essaye en rentrant. (vos commentaires sont les derniers espoirs^^)

    Sinon oui j'utilise du PWM, fCpu 8Mhz fPwm 125Khz je vous confirme ce soir.

  22. #18
    bobflux

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    > le problème c'est que c'est pile poil pour le boitier

    si tu mets des CMS, ça rentre plus facilement

  23. Publicité
  24. #19
    morpheus87

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Bonjour,

    qu'est que tu as derriere le connecteur main out?

    mets un condensateur de 10nf entre la patte reset et la masse
    mets une resistance de 10k entre VCC et la reset



    prends la masse du mosfet directement sur ton connecteur d'alimentation
    prend le vcc du moteur directement sur ton connecteur d'alimentation

    mets l'alimentation de IC2P apres C1

    une resistance + zener apres C2 et D1 ne ferait pas de mal.

    PD3 m'intrigue....

    patte 4 et 3 de IC2 relier apres C2

    voila dans un premier temps.

    manque peut etre des resistances autour du 4511...

  25. #20
    Canaillou2k5

    Post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    qu'est que tu as derriere le connecteur main out? - en photo message page 1 #7 (je vais le faire sous eagle pour que ce soit bien clair)

    mets un condensateur de 10nf entre la patte reset et la masse - j'en ait un de 100nF uniquement avec les pattes longues je suppose que c'est bon.

    mets une resistance de 10k entre VCC et la reset - meme si c'est directement relié?

    prends la masse du mosfet directement sur ton connecteur d'alimentation - c'est fait par un pont

    prend le vcc du moteur directement sur ton connecteur d'alimentation - c'est déja le cas pas le connecteur main out

    mets l'alimentation de IC2P apres C1 - ça ca m'interesse pas trop puisque l'afficher consome pas mal et j'ai peut que mon système diode+condensateur ne suffisent pas pour compenser l'appel sur courant du moteur et coupe mon microcontrôleur...

    une resistance + zener apres C2 et D1 ne ferait pas de mal. - je n'ai pas de zener, tant pis.. au pire combien de volts?

    PD3 m'intrigue.... - retour du capteur de vitesse

    patte 4 et 3 de IC2 relier apres C2 - c2 dans le routage est dédié à IC2

    voila dans un premier temps.

    manque peut etre des resistances autour du 4511... - j'ai multiplexer les digits de façon à ne pas avoir besoin de résistances pour les leds si c'est ca donc tu veut parler...

  26. #21
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Voilà la suite du connecteur.

    J'ai également remise le schéma de base en heut résolution.
    Images attachées Images attachées

  27. #22
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Quelques infos sur ce moteur également, il tourne assez mal naturellement (la vitesse oscille entre 186 et 166 tours par secondes d'après mon micro mais ça s'entend au bruit il tourne pas rond)

    Il y avait 4 petit condos de l'ordre du pico farad (petit orange).

    Je les avais tous enlevés, mais impossible alors de lire la vitesse tellement que le capteur était perturbé.

    J'ai remis les deux qui étant branchés ainsi: un au plus un au moins, et un point communs entre les deux et la carcasse du moteur.

    J'ai pas remis les deux qui étaient entre le plus et le moins; mais là je vient de mettre un 100nF et ça à l'air d'aider...

  28. #23
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Capteur de vitesse débranché et plus de problème!

    Je vient de faire tourner le moteur deux fois 10 minutes à deux vitesses différentes (40% et 100%) sans aucun problème.

    Dès que je branche le capteur au bout de qq secondes ça saute à grande vitesse et au bout de quelque minute à petite vitesse.

    C'est à n'y rien comprendre; mon capteur de vitesse est un OPB620; résistance de protection de la diode 470ohm; résistance de saturation du transistor 1K ohm.

    il est branché sur int 1.

    Là je sèche vraiment.

  29. #24
    DAUDET78

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Citation Envoyé par Canaillou2k5 Voir le message
    résistance de protection de la diode 470ohm
    donc If= (5-1,25)/470=8 mA
    résistance de saturation du transistor 1K ohm.
    C'est une résistance de PullUP ou de PullDown? De toutes les façons, la charge sur le phototransistor ne doit pas faire passer plus de 160 µA dans celui-ci. Donc elle doit être plus grande que 31K
    L'age n'est pas un handicap .... Encore faut-il arriver jusque là pour le constater !

  30. Publicité
  31. #25
    DAUDET78

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Le câble qui va à ton capteur est blindé ?
    L'age n'est pas un handicap .... Encore faut-il arriver jusque là pour le constater !

  32. #26
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Non c'est un câble plat à 4 fils.

    Je vais déjà rectifier la résistance du transistor.

    A petite vitesse ça ne plante pas, mais à grande vitesse oui; je vais donc dans un premier temps agrandir l'espace dans la roue qui passe dans le "U" du capteur.
    Dernière modification par Canaillou2k5 ; 02/09/2011 à 12h13.

  33. #27
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Je vient de regarder pour le transistor, je suis à (5-0,4)/1000 soit 4,6mA, c'est correcte sachant que le max est de 30mA non ?

  34. #28
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    voilà le signal provenant du capteur:

    http://www.youtube.com/watch?v=su1ptiIqDXI

  35. #29
    Canaillou2k5

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Problème résolu !

    J'ai mit l'oscillateur interne en fonctionnement plutôt que le quartz; il n'y à plus de raz.

    Mon application ne nécessite pas de très grosse précision.

    A part le fait que je n'ai pas collé le quartz à la platine (5mm de haut) je ne vois pas ou ça clochait; je ne sait pas si ça peut jourer sinon c'est le routage pourris!

    Merci pour votre aide.

  36. #30
    dualvsta2

    Re : Reset micro contrôleur aléatoire S.O.S S.OS besoin d'aide très rapidement projet à finir ce soi

    Bonsoir

    J'aurais juste aimé connaitre le role de D1 sur le schéma ?

    Content que tu es résolu ton problème. J'en ai chier ( enfin j'en chie toujours ) avec ma carte moteur

Sur le même thème :

Page 1 sur 2 1 DernièreDernière

Discussions similaires

  1. Micro controleur: Salut on a besoin d'aide pour les ppe ( Tsi )
    Par crynorris dans le forum Électronique
    Réponses: 0
    Dernier message: 25/02/2010, 14h18
  2. PPE sciences de l'ingé, besoin d'aide pour finir !
    Par boliboli dans le forum TPE / TIPE et autres travaux
    Réponses: 2
    Dernier message: 26/02/2009, 14h38
  3. Besoin d'aide rapidement !!!
    Par mg0902 dans le forum Chimie
    Réponses: 3
    Dernier message: 16/02/2009, 21h14
  4. [Blanc] Besoin d'aide rapidement
    Par le maarifien dans le forum Dépannage
    Réponses: 4
    Dernier message: 15/10/2008, 23h20
  5. [Génétique] Besoin d'aide assez rapidement
    Par Cannot dans le forum Biologie
    Réponses: 5
    Dernier message: 14/10/2008, 20h34